Your question is to hard to answer without providing more details i.e. inclusions, type of construction etc.

In canberra builders go of living square i.e. 9.3 sqm (or thereabouts). Most builders in canberra charge approx $1500 a sqm. Therefore for a 140 sqm dwelling it could cost you about $210k

Ontop of this you have to add garage $16 approx for single and 32k for double.

The pricing structures differ with the type of builder you get i.e. project home builder or a more commercial builder.

For a project this size i would strongly recommend a project builder you can trust.

purchase price + major building works - depreciation (regardless of whether you claim or not)

(please check this with an accountant first)
